在这个科技日新月异的时代,智能锁已经逐渐成为家庭、办公场所的标配。好汉智能锁作为市场上备受好评的产品,以其先进的技术和便捷的使用体验赢得了众多消费者的喜爱。然而,随着智能锁的普及,关于其安全性的问题也日益凸显。今天,我们就来揭秘破解好汉智能锁的五大技巧,同时为大家提供安全使用攻略,让您的智能生活更加安心。
技巧一:了解好汉智能锁的工作原理
首先,要想破解好汉智能锁,我们需要对其工作原理有深入的了解。好汉智能锁通常采用指纹、密码、卡片、手机APP等多种开锁方式,其核心是通过生物识别技术或加密算法来验证身份。因此,破解好汉智能锁的关键在于绕过这些验证方式。
代码示例:指纹识别算法原理
# 模拟指纹识别算法原理
def fingerprint_recognition(fingerprint_template, input_fingerprint):
# 假设指纹模板与输入指纹相似度为0.8以上为验证成功
similarity = calculate_similarity(fingerprint_template, input_fingerprint)
if similarity >= 0.8:
return True
else:
return False
def calculate_similarity(template, input_fingerprint):
# 计算指纹相似度的函数(示例)
# 实际应用中,指纹相似度计算更为复杂
return 0.9 # 假设模板与输入指纹相似度为0.9
# 测试指纹识别
fingerprint_template = "指纹模板数据"
input_fingerprint = "用户输入的指纹数据"
result = fingerprint_recognition(fingerprint_template, input_fingerprint)
print("指纹验证成功" if result else "指纹验证失败")
技巧二:设置复杂的密码
为了提高好汉智能锁的安全性,建议用户设置复杂的密码。密码应包含大小写字母、数字和特殊字符,且长度不少于8位。此外,避免使用生日、电话号码等容易被猜到的信息作为密码。
代码示例:生成随机密码
import random
import string
def generate_password(length=8):
characters = string.ascii_letters + string.digits + string.punctuation
return ''.join(random.choice(characters) for _ in range(length))
# 生成随机密码
password = generate_password()
print("生成的随机密码:", password)
技巧三:定期更换密码和指纹
为了防止密码和指纹被破解,建议用户定期更换密码和指纹。更换频率可以根据个人需求和安全等级进行调整。
技巧四:关闭远程开锁功能
好汉智能锁通常具备远程开锁功能,但这也意味着您的智能锁可能面临远程破解的风险。因此,建议关闭远程开锁功能,只保留本地开锁方式。
技巧五:关注软件更新和系统安全
好汉智能锁的软件和系统需要定期更新,以确保安全性能。用户应关注官方发布的更新信息,及时更新智能锁的软件和系统。
总结
通过以上五大技巧,我们可以有效提高好汉智能锁的安全性。当然,除了这些技巧,用户还需养成良好的使用习惯,如不随意透露密码和指纹信息,避免将智能锁放置在容易被破坏的地方等。只有这样,我们才能在享受智能锁带来的便捷的同时,确保家庭和办公场所的安全。
